#db1cbb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db1cbb is composed of 85.9% red, 11%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 14.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 310.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#db1cbb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#b70077.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#db1cbb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db1cbb has RGB values of R:219, G:28,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.15,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14359739.

Shades and Tints of #db1cbb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0109 is the darkest color, while #fef8fd is the lightest one.
